The columns in the previous example are identified as follows: • N:S:P. The physical position of the port, in the syntax node:slot:port. • State. State of the port. ◦ ready. The port is online and ready for use. ◦ loss_sync.The port is not physically connected to anything. ◦ config_wait. Firmware has yet to be initialized. ◦ login_wait. Fibre Channel adapter is attempting port and process logins with all loop ports. ◦ error. Fibre Channel adapter has experienced an unrecoverable error. ◦ non_participate. Port is logically isolated from the Fibre Channel loop. ◦ offline. The port is offline. • HwAddr. A unique identifier of the port hardware used for Remote Copy connection. For an RCIP port, it is the MAC address of the port. • IPAddr. The IP address of the Remote Copy interface. • Netmask. Netmask for the Ethernet port. • Gateway. Gateway address for the Remote Copy interface. • MTU. Maximum Transfer Unit (MTU) size for the specified Remote Copy interface (default is 1500). The largest supported value is 9000 and the smallest is 100. • Rate. Data transfer rate for the Remote Copy interface. • Duplex. Values can be either Full or Half. • AutoNeg.
